2004 BMW 545 vs. 1990 Skoda L
To start off, 2004 BMW 545 is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Skoda L.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Skoda L would be higher. At 4,398 cc (8 cylinders), 2004 BMW 545 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 BMW 545 (315 HP @ 7750 RPM) has 258 more horse power than 1990 Skoda L. (57 HP @ 5200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 BMW 545 should accelerate faster than 1990 Skoda L.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 BMW 545 weights approximately 895 kg more than 1990 Skoda L.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 BMW 545 (447 Nm) has 357 more torque (in Nm) than 1990 Skoda L. (90 Nm). This means 2004 BMW 545 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1990 Skoda L.
Compare all specifications:
2004 BMW 545 | 1990 Skoda L | |
Make | BMW | Skoda |
Model | 545 | L |
Year Released | 2004 | 1990 |
Engine Position | Front | Rear |
Engine Size | 4398 cc | 1221 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 315 HP | 57 HP |
Engine RPM | 7750 RPM | 5200 RPM |
Torque | 447 Nm | 90 Nm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.5:1 | 9.5:1 |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1780 kg | 885 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4850 mm | 4170 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1850 mm | 1600 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1480 mm | 1410 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2830 mm | 2410 mm |
